To support research and development, the Honourable Andrew Parsons, KC, Minister of Industry, Energy and Technology, today announced $553,693 in funding for SiftMed under the Business Growth Program.

SiftMed’s platform uses machine learning and artificial intelligence to sort medical-related documents. The company is working to expand its technology to a predictive analytics model in order to:

  • Help users quickly assess claim health issues;
  • Create a more efficient risk assessment process; and,
  • Accurately predict medical claim complexities, identify potential health concerns within a claim that could identify and triage a claim as complex.

As part of this funding, SiftMed will undertake a 13-month research and development project to enhance the company’s existing product and provide better understanding of medical claim complexities and trends. Funding from the Provincial Government will support six new technical positions.

SiftMed is also receiving advisory services and up to $400,000 in research and development funding from the National Research Council of Canada Industrial Research Assistance Program (NRC IRAP) to further develop its medical AI technology.

SiftMed Inc. is an innovative technology company located in St. John’s, Newfoundland and Labrador. The company was created to organize medical files for Independent Medical Examiners (IMEs). Since its incorporation, the company has grown to 18 full-time employees and a board of advisors and directors. Today the company works with law firms, IMEs and insurance companies to solve the problem of sifting through medical records.
